Transaction 7162d46cb07d67ad15fd1fd440ea2c5e1b953cad8cd99c7647bd44dc25030bc2

2 Input
1 Outputs
  • 7162d46cb07d67ad15fd1fd440ea2c5e1b953cad8cd99c7647bd44dc25030bc2:0
  • value  1091709
    address  3LbPTDr1Fz3AKeCN9rTkYD8s5WAze11NY1